Double Decker Tram

HK Tram Double Decker Tram

The Tram has been serving the Hong Kong for almost 100 years. It's the cheapest and best way to view the city life. The tram runs on the north side of Hong Kong Island and costs only HK$2.00. 

The Tram passes many of the tallest skyscrapers in Hong Kong, the financial center, street markets, Hong Kong Park, busy shopping districts, and housing estates. You can pretty much see it all if you go end-to-end! Get a window seat on the upper deck and avoid the tram during rushing hours as it gets very crowded.

Advise: Trams trundle along the northern side of Hong Kong Island. No change is given so be sure you have the exact fare. Or pay with your Octopus card.

 

The longest route starts in Western Market and runs all the way to Shau Kei Wan, while other may run only part of the way. (ie: Western Market to Causeway Bay or perhaps Happy Valley) Trams operate from 5:07 am to 12:40 am and come by every two (2) to twelve (12) minutes.
